Well it is a mystery to me and however much I search my many books on French Napoleonic Artillery, every modeller's on line catalogue etc, this is the only image I can find. The label does notwithstand enlarging alas. Please put me out of my misery some kind soul.
|
| Artilleryman | 23 Sep 2025 2:02 a.m. PST |
This is a Gribeauval wagon built to carry 250 pioneer tools or five tons of powder. It could also take a coffer at the front to carry spare parts for the division's vehicles. There would be a number of such wagons with each horse artillery unit. |

| Bernard1809 | 23 Sep 2025 6:54 a.m. PST |
Il s'agit d'un fourgon à munitions. Les munitions sont transportées de leur lieu de fabrication vers le parc de l'armée en campagne dans ces fourgons (convoyés par le train des équipages). Les munitions sont en vrac. Au parc, les munitions sont conditionnées et mises dans des caissons d'artillerie (convoyés par le train d'artillerie). Puis distribuées aux différentes unités. Les fourgons ne sont pas étanches, les caissons sont étanches aux intempéries. |
